DHARWAD: On day two of the SSLC examination, three students were debarred in Haveri and Dharwad for indulging in malpractice. While two students belonged to Haveri district, the other was from Dharwad district. Three teachers, including a headmaster, were relieved from supervision work for not adhering to the examination guidelines.
Cheating
Deputy Director of Public Instructions, Haveri, said H.M. Halemani was found indulging in malpractice at the Hurulikoppi examination centre in Savanur taluk, Manjunath Tatti was found doing the same at the examination centre in Basavanneppa High School, Herur in Hangal taluk. Durgappa N. Talawar was debarred from a centre in Navalgund taluk. The DDPI of Dharwad V.M. Patil said a headmaster attached to an examination centre in Dharwad who was officiating as superintendent was relieved from duty for failing to follow the guidelines. In Gadag district, the DDPI of Gadag relieved two teachers from examination supervision work. In view of the mathematics examination on Thursday, security outside certain examination centres was tightened.
Increase in security
At the Presentation School in Dharwad where it was reported that outsiders entered the premises on Wednesday, the police had increased security. At several centres, the examination was videotaped.
